Loading...
--- Libc/Libc-391.4.2/sys/nanosleep.2
+++ Libc/Libc-262/sys/nanosleep.2
@@ -40,7 +40,7 @@
.Os
.Sh NAME
.Nm nanosleep
-.Nd suspend thread execution for an interval measured in nanoseconds
+.Nd suspend process execution for an interval measured in nanoseconds
.Sh LIBRARY
.Lb libc
.Sh SYNOPSIS
@@ -49,10 +49,7 @@
.Fn nanosleep "const struct timespec *rqtp" "struct timespec *rmtp"
.Sh DESCRIPTION
.Fn Nanosleep
-causes the calling thread to sleep for the specified time
-(the actual time slept may be longer, due to system latencies
-and possible limitations in the timer resolution of the hardware).
-An unmasked signal will
+causes the process to sleep for the specified time. An unmasked signal will
cause it to terminate the sleep early, regardless of the
.Dv SA_RESTART
value on the interrupting signal.